A women's chorus:

The Grieg Ladies promote musical culture by singing in the English and Scandinavian languages. These enthusiastic women endeavor to keep the rich heritage of Scandinavian music alive by performing its folk tunes and traditional songs throughout the Chicagoland area.

Directed by:
Caroline Uhlig

Caroline received her B.A. in music from Northeastern University with background in piano and organ performance. For 26 years she has directed secular and sacred choirs throughout Chicagoland.
